This animal is the fennec fox. ‎ ‎ Fennec foxes have ears that are 5 to 6 inches long. That’s big for an animal that weighs less than four pounds. Their ears help shed(去除)body heat. And, as you may have guessed, they also provide great hearing.‎ ‎ It’s also interesting to think about the hair of fennec foxes. Why would a fox that lives in the desert need a thick, fur coat? Actually, the desert isn’t always warm. During the nighttime, a desert can be terribly cold! A fennec fox’s fur keeps them warm during those desert nights. They also have long bushy tails that they use as a blanket. And the hair on their feet protects them from the hot sand in the daytime.‎ ‎ Fennec foxes live in small communities of dens(兽穴).They spend most of the day sleeping in their dens, out of the hot sun. Then, when night comes, they come out in search of food. In addition to their great hearing, fennecs also use their great sense of smell and big eyes to track down dinner.‎ ‎ Like other foxes, fennecs are omnivores. This means they eat both meat and plants. They like ‎ eating birds, eggs, insects, snails, fruit and leaves best.‎ ‎ Fennec fox mothers have one to five babies at a time. The lifespan of a fennec fox is 10 to 12 years. The cream coloration of fennec foxes help them blend into their desert habitat. Still, they have to watch out for predators(捕食性动物). These include caracals ( a type of wild cat ) , jackals, eagle owls, hyenas and humans. To many people, the world has become smaller. Of course this does not mean that the world is really becoming smaller. It means that the world seems smaller. Two hundred years ago, communication between two countries took a long time. In the 17th and 18th centuries, it took six weeks for news from Europe to reach America. This time difference influenced people’s actions. For example, a fight, or a war in 1812 between England and the United States could have been avoided (避免). A peace agreement had already been signed (签署). Peace was made in England, but the news of peace took six weeks to reach America. During these six weeks, the large and serious War of New Orleans was fought. Many people lost their lives after the peace agreement had been signed. In the past, communication took much more time than it does now.‎ ‎ With the help of modern technology, it’s much easier to get more information within a short time.
